Hello, I'm french, sorry for my bad english :(
I have a problem with my kernel: Time runs exactly three times too fast.
I tested the kernel 2.6.8.1 and the 2.6.9-rc1, no success.
It is really strange because yesterday I reinstalled my debian with a kernel
2.6.8.1 (made by me): Time ran correctly. And this morning when I rebooted my
computer (Compaq presario R3000 series, R3215EA exactly) the time is running
again three times too fast (with the kernel 2.6.8.1 and 2.6.9-rc1).
All my applications (KDE, command "date"...) runs three times too fast. It's
very annoying.
My /dev/cpuinfo :
presario:~# cat /proc/cpuinfo
processor : 0
vendor_id : AuthenticAMD
cpu family : 15
model : 12
model name : AMD Athlon(tm) XP Processor 3000+
stepping : 0
cpu MHz : 266.127
cache size : 256 KB
fdiv_bug : no
hlt_bug : no
f00f_bug : no
coma_bug : no
fpu : yes
fpu_exception : yes
cpuid level : 1
wp : yes
flags : fpu vme de pse tsc msr pae mce cx8 apic sep mtrr pge mca
cmovpat pse36 clflush mmx fxsr sse sse2 syscall nx mmxext 3dnowext 3dnow
bogomips : 517.12
